Texas could see energy demand double by 2031
Katharine Finnerty | Source: Spectrum News | Posted 04/15/2025

AUSTIN, Texas — A new report from Texas’ power grid operator projects the Lone Star State will see energy demand more than double over the next five years.

A recent report from the Electric Reliability Council of Texas (ERCOT) indicates that the state's energy demand could more than double by 2031, with a projected peak demand of 218 gigawatts. This is a significant increase from the current record of 85.5 gigawatts set in August 2023. ERCOT also provided a lower forecast, estimating a peak demand of 145 gigawatts, which accounts for a slowdown in growth from large load projects such as data centers and crypto mines, which are driving much of the demand increase.
The report highlights the need for improvements in Texas's power grid, especially after the 2021 winter storm that caused widespread outages. Legislative efforts, including Senate Bill 6, aim to enhance grid reliability and address the rising demand from large energy consumers. Texas leaders, including Lt. Gov. Dan Patrick and Gov. Greg Abbott, emphasize the importance of ensuring a reliable and affordable power supply to support the state's growing economy and population, while also noting the state's advancements in renewable energy sources.
